Biologically Inspired Robotics

study guides for every class

that actually explain what's on your next test

Fine-tuning

from class:

Biologically Inspired Robotics

Definition

Fine-tuning refers to the process of making small adjustments or optimizations to a model or algorithm to improve its performance and accuracy. This is crucial in the context of artificial intelligence and machine learning, as it helps ensure that the system can effectively adapt to new data, tasks, or environments, enhancing its overall functionality.

congrats on reading the definition of fine-tuning.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Fine-tuning often involves adjusting weights and biases in neural networks to minimize loss functions and enhance predictive accuracy.
  2. It can be applied after a model has been pre-trained on a large dataset, allowing it to adapt to specific tasks with fewer resources and less time.
  3. The fine-tuning process can involve techniques like gradient descent, where small steps are taken in the direction that reduces errors.
  4. Effective fine-tuning requires careful consideration of the learning rate, as too high of a rate can lead to overshooting optimal values.
  5. Successful fine-tuning can significantly reduce the amount of labeled data needed for training, making it an efficient strategy for many machine learning applications.

Review Questions

  • How does fine-tuning improve the performance of machine learning models?
    • Fine-tuning enhances machine learning models by allowing them to adapt their parameters based on specific data or tasks after an initial training phase. By making incremental adjustments to weights and biases, models can learn more relevant features that are crucial for improving accuracy. This is especially beneficial when applying pre-trained models to new tasks, as fine-tuning helps bridge the gap between general knowledge and task-specific requirements.
  • What are some common challenges encountered during the fine-tuning process in AI models?
    • Common challenges during fine-tuning include determining the appropriate learning rate, avoiding overfitting to the fine-tuning dataset, and ensuring that the model does not lose valuable information learned during pre-training. Additionally, selecting which layers of a neural network to fine-tune can impact overall performance, as some layers may need more adjustment than others depending on the complexity of the new task. Managing these factors is essential for successful implementation.
  • Evaluate the impact of fine-tuning on transfer learning in artificial intelligence applications.
    • Fine-tuning plays a crucial role in enhancing transfer learning by enabling pre-trained models to efficiently adapt to new tasks with minimal additional training. By leveraging previously acquired knowledge through fine-tuning, models can achieve high levels of accuracy even when limited labeled data is available. This not only speeds up the development process but also reduces computational costs. As a result, fine-tuning maximizes the utility of existing models and broadens their applicability across various domains.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ides